How to fix?

Upgrade torvalds/linux to version 4.13 or higher.

Overview

Affected versions of this package are vulnerable to Denial of Service (DoS). A flaw was found in the hugetlb_mcopy_atomic_pte function in mm/hugetlb.c in the Linux kernel before 4.13. A superfluous implicit page unlock for VM_SHARED hugetlbfs mapping could trigger a local denial of service (BUG).
